Jogging routes around Schmogrow-Fehrow traverse the tranquil natural features of Lower Lusatia in Brandenburg, Germany. The region is characterized by flat, accessible paths, including well-maintained asphalt trails and circular routes. Numerous waterways, such as the Malxe and Hammergraben rivers forming the Große Fließ, offer scenic running alongside water. The area is largely part of the Spreewald Biosphere Reserve, providing a peaceful environment for running.

Anyone stopping by Lake Willischza – whether by bike, on a hike, or simply for a swim – will sooner or later pass by the Seehotel Burg. And that's not a bad idea. The large yellow building with a red roof may at first glance look like a cross between a day-trip restaurant and a conference hotel – but the impression is deceptive. Those who stop in will find honest cuisine, generous portions, and a seat with a view of the greenery – or even the lake itself. For cyclists, the Seehotel is a reliable address: There are bike racks, outdoor seating, restrooms (also for non-guests), and service that is friendly but not intrusive. The menu is down-to-earth – from fried potatoes to fish dishes to ice cream sundaes – everything your body could need after a tour. The rooms themselves are solid, the prices are moderate, and the location is ideal. And anyone sitting on the terrace in the early evening and watching the sunset over the lake will quickly realize: that's all you need right now.

Anyone traveling along the Spree Cycle Path between Burg and Cottbus and needing a break off the road will find a pleasantly shady shelter nestled in the pine forest just beyond the small town of Schlossberg. The shelter is located directly on the paved route and offers sturdy benches, a covered table, and even a wastebasket—a simple but useful feature, just what you'd want on long stretches. The spot is ideal for a snack, repacking, or simply taking a breather in the shade. In the off-season, it's often deserted—apart from the occasional walker or forestry vehicle. There's no drinking water source, but instead peace, birdsong, and a touch of the Brandenburg region's originality. A good stopover if you're traveling to Cottbus from the Gurken Cycle Path, or if you just want to escape for a while—into the forest, into the present.

What kind of terrain can I expect on the running trails in Schmogrow-Fehrow?

The running trails in Schmogrow-Fehrow are predominantly flat and accessible. Many paths, like sections of the Nordumfluter cycle path, are well-maintained asphalt, winding through meadows and offering expansive views. You'll also find routes alongside waterways, providing a peaceful and scenic running experience within the Spreewald Biosphere Reserve.

What natural features or landmarks can I see while running in Schmogrow-Fehrow?

The region is rich in natural beauty, particularly within the Spreewald Biosphere Reserve. You can run alongside waterways like the Malxe and Hammergraben rivers, which form the Große Fließ. Notable landmarks include the Bismarck Tower, Burg (Spreewald), and you might pass by the Burg Spreewald Harbor.
